Faith and Self-control - Teaching Material
As we reflect on Joshua 1:9, we hear God’s command to Joshua: “Be strong and courageous. Do not be afraid; do not be discouraged, for the LORD your God will be with you wherever you go.” This powerful reminder speaks not only to Joshua's leadership but also to our daily lives. When faced with decisions that require self-control and discernment—be it in our relationships, our work, or our personal struggles—God’s presence is our guiding light.
Self-control, often perceived as mere restraint, is more profoundly about aligning our actions with God's will. It invites us to reflect on how deeply we are rooted in the agape love of God, which empowers us to make choices that honor Him and serve others. When we face temptations or anxiety, we can find strength in turning our eyes toward Him, trusting that He is with us, offering guidance and purpose.
Consider a moment in your life when you were faced with a tough decision. Perhaps it was a choice involving integrity at work or the courage to mend a broken relationship. Remember the feeling of uncertainty, but also the quiet assurance that came from seeking God’s direction. In those moments, self-control was not just about saying “no” to something; it was about saying “yes” to God’s call.
Let us cultivate a heart that seeks to reflect God’s love in our decisions, knowing that our commitment to self-control is rooted in a relationship with a God who guides us with unwavering love. Trust in Him, and let that trust transform every decision into an opportunity for spiritual growth and deeper love.
